What Does a Pampered Chef Consultant Do?
Pampered Chef consultants help customers discover kitchen tools, cookware, pantry products, recipes, and meal solutions.
Consultants can sell through:
- Virtual parties
- In-person parties
- Catalog parties
- Fundraisers
- Bridal or wedding showers
- Individual customer orders
- Personal shopping links
You do not need to hold inventory or personally ship customer orders. Customers order through Pampered Chef, and their products are shipped from the company’s warehouse.

How Do Pampered Chef Consultants Earn Money?
Pampered Chef consultants begin earning 20% commission on personal sales and can grow from there.
Consultants who build a team may also qualify to earn additional compensation based on team sales.
When enrolled in direct deposit, consultants are paid twice a month:
- Orders submitted from the first through the fifteenth are generally included in the payment on the twenty-second.
- Orders submitted from the sixteenth through the end of the month are generally included in the payment on the eighth of the following month.

Do You Need to Buy Inventory?
Pampered Chef does not require consultants to keep an inventory of products.
When customers place orders, Pampered Chef processes and ships those orders directly to them.
You may choose to purchase products to use, demonstrate, photograph, or share during parties, but you do not need to maintain shelves of merchandise to resell.
Pampered Chef also states that there are no minimum personal product purchases after joining.
How Much Does It Cost to Join Pampered Chef?
Pampered Chef offers different launch-kit options, and the prices and contents can change.
Some kits contain a smaller selection of tools for someone who wants an inexpensive way to begin. Larger kits may include more products for consultants who want additional tools to demonstrate or use in their own kitchens.
Before joining, review the current options carefully. Choose a kit based on:
- What you can afford
- Which products you will actually use
- Whether you plan to demonstrate products
- How quickly you want to begin holding parties
- Your personal business goals
Do not spend more than your budget allows simply because a larger kit looks exciting.
